  • So, is it getting quieter here in the #Fediverse; is it even dying?
    schnurrito@discuss.tchncs.deundefined schnurrito@discuss.tchncs.de

    I think we need to ask this question separately for the microblogging fediverse and the "threadiverse" (i.e. Lemmy-compatible communities).

    The microblogging fediverse isn't dying, I scroll through it every day, it's one of my main sources of news (some of which I then post on Lemmy). I wouldn't be able to keep up with much more than what I currently get into my feed there.

    The threadiverse meanwhile could definitely use much more activity. I hope it eventually becomes a place to discuss even the most niche topics imaginable, like web forums in their era...

  • Did something change recently with how Mastodon displays content from Lemmy / the threadiverse?
    schnurrito@discuss.tchncs.deundefined schnurrito@discuss.tchncs.de

    I looked at the two complaints you linked to and at how those threads seem to be displayed on these users' instances:

    • https://sfba.social/@otters_raft@lemmy.ca/115267196743748430
    • https://mas.to/@otters_raft@lemmy.ca/115283224174559468

    (edit: I don't know why they aren't displaying as links, but changing them to have a link text doesn't help either, so I'm keeping them like this)

    That looks the same as it has always looked, to the best of my knowledge. I've gotten at least one similar complaint before, from a Mastodon user who didn't understand what they were looking at when they got a Lemmy post in their timeline. So I think the answer to your question is no, nothing changed, either it is a coincidence that you got two such complaints within a few days, or what actually changed is that your posts have (for whatever reason) become more visible on Mastodon.
